What is NFC and how it Works Near Field Communication or NFC is a system that allows you to communicate or gather data using the electromagnetic radio fields emitted by NFC enabled devices. The system is similar to Bluetooth or Wi-Fi since it allows transfer or exchange of data wirelessly. RFID is another system that is close to what NFC does but the latter must be close to other NFC devices for the technology to work.

NFC is available in two forms: passive and active NFC.

Passive devices like an NFC tag contain data which other devices can read. For example, a magazine with a tag may contain additional information which you may read if you scan the code using your NFC enabled device.

On the other hand, active NFC is present in smart phones. The devices have the ability to extract and interpret data from passive NFC. In the example above, the active device is the NFC enabled smart phones. What?s great about devices with active NFC system is that you can also share the acquired information. Nowadays, it is possible to indentify or track a person, animal, or object using a state of the art technology of radio frequency identification or RFID. The system relies on the radio frequency electromagnetic fields to transfer data needed for identification or tracking. A person with a RFID chip for instance can be identified or traced since the chip contains the information of the person which is automatically read by a RFID reader.

Uses of RFID Right now, RFID technology has been applied to numerous industries since tracking and identification are important actions in controlling inventories and assets of the businesses. For example, RFID chips are used in production of electronic devices like mobile phones, TVs, PCs and more since it is easier for workers to track the progress of the objects when they can simply scan the items during production. Meanwhile farmers can now easily identify their farm animals individually because each tag can be written or stored with specific information. For instance, if a farmer maintains hundreds of cows he can immediately identify his prized bull by simply using the RFID scanner to scan the animalÕs location.

Meanwhile, individuals can now pay for their items without using actual money or even credit card. Device such as mobile phones equipped with RFID tags can transfer payment wirelessly. It is now possible to turn ordinary mobile phones into devices capable of transferring payment and also as RFID reader. The chip is wired directly to your bank information so you can use your phone to pay for stuff so you wonÕt have to carry money or credit card anymore. Of course, since the RFID chip contains your sensitive information, security features are added to the system for safe transactions.
